As a followup to my article asking if college students are too politically correct, I had comedian Jay Black on my show. Jay, who lives in Marlton, gave up a career as a school teacher to pursue comedy. Jay has performed at over 700 colleges nationwide and boasts awards including:

- The 2009 Campus Magazines Comedian of the Year, both

- The 2013 and 2014 APCA College Comedian of the Year

- 2013 all-around College Performer of the Year.

Jay has also co-wrote and co-starred in the movie "Meet My Valentine" which aired in prime time on the ION channel.

Jay definitely sees the change in the college crowd and talks about the effect of being raised in an anti-bullying atmosphere and what it does to their ability to appreciate sarcasm. He also discusses the college backlash of Jerry Seinfeld's comments that he won't play colleges anymore.
